Lot Description

A gold plated manual wind gentleman's Cricket alarm wrist watch by Vulcain, the silvered dial with hourly applied gilt markers, bordered by a minute track, the round case, numbered 305012, fitted to an associated brown leather strap with pin buckle. Case diameter 34mm. With box and papers.

Papers: Yes

Postage: Auction Default

Weight: No

Total lot weight: No

Vulcain wrist watch, movement currently is functioning, dial has light surface scratches and small dark marks visible, hands appear to be tarnished and have surface marks missing, glass has light scratches which may polish out, case has light scratches and scuffs from use, case back has scratches, crown and pusher have surface scratches and metal appears tarnished and rubbed, fitted to leather strap which shows signs of wear with creases and light rubbing to the leather, pin buckle appears to have surface scratches.


This lot comes with box and papers.


Due to the opening of the case back we recommend that this lot be resealed by an authorised technicnan before use near water.
